Application
This compound is primarily used in advanced material science research, particularly in the synthesis of photoactive polymers and liquid crystal displays (LCDs). Its unique structure allows for cross-linking under UV light, making it valuable in photoresist formulations. Researchers also explore its potential in organic electronics due to its conjugated aromatic systems. The compound’s bifunctional reactivity enables precise modifications for tailored macromolecular architectures.
